Transaction d590d03e862426238bb1bba1e050c72c7b8aac7e5227fda9f883bfa75077746e
1 Input
1 Output
-
d590d03e862426238bb1bba1e050c72c7b8aac7e5227fda9f883bfa75077746e:0
- value
- 1327265
- script pubkey
- OP_0 OP_PUSHBYTES_32 00196c8e1ca20ab17ebc07c5bdd2adf1961567b8f5a0a9b45c91eb5917b762b9
- address
- bc1qqqvkersu5g9tzl4uqlzmm54d7xtp2eac7ks2ndzuj844j9ahv2usq4m2jl